Taoiseach Simon Harris appoints Nikki Bradley to Seanad Éireann
- Published on: 10 July 2024
- Last updated on: 12 April 2025
The Taoiseach has selected Nikki Bradley as the Taoiseach’s nominee to Seanad Éireann.
Ms Bradley is to replace Regina Doherty, who was elected to the European Parliament.
The Taoiseach said:
“Nikki’s extensive advocacy work and commitment will undoubtedly contribute significantly to our legislative process.
“Nikki’s journey is truly inspirational, and she will be an important voice in Seanad Éireann for people with disabilities.
“I know she will work tirelessly and will use her invaluable insight and knowledge to push for a better quality of life for others in Ireland and I look forward to working with her.
“I also want to thank Regina Doherty for her work in the Seanad and wish her well in her new role as a member of the European Parliament.”
